Coming Soon - Whisky Craft Auchentoshan 20 Year Old Cask Strength Single Malt Scotch Whisky (700ml)
A touch of something tropical here. The citric, grassy character of Auchentoshan's youth has transformed into softer notes of papaya and unripe banana, bringing an unsweetened rum-like edge. Nicely balanced at natural strength, and given the price/age ratio, well worth considering for followers of this distillery. 225 bottles from a second-fill hogshead. 55.1% Alc./Vol. Non chill filtered.
Other reviews... It's fresh and lemony, with saline and mineral notes that give it character—chalk, gypsum, limestone. But very quickly, juicy fruits emerge: Williams pear, mirabelle plum, and cotton candy, strawberry bubble gum, with a lovely caramel coulis and pastry cream. On the palate, grapefruit and mountain honey, orange zest, and ripe banana. The spices are very subtle. The finish is shortbread, a pinch of salt, then it becomes herbaceous: mint, sage, reeds. A very light peppery touch, oak leaf, walnut. I enjoyed the fruits, the citrus, the cotton candy, but above all, what surprised me was the mineral character which gives a real personality to the whole. - whiskybase.com
Notes from the bottlers... Nose: Fresh and zesty, opening with lemon zest, limoncello, honey, and a touch of mint. Grassy notes add brightness and depth. Palate: Light and refined, with orange oil and soft citrus notes unfolding smoothly. Finish: Clean and lively, with a peppery kick and a zesty lift that lingers at the back of the tongue.
